A JRPG Gatekeeping Nightmare for Newcomers

Metaphor is the most boring and overrated game I’ve played in my entire gaming life. If you’re not already into JRPGs, DO NOT touch it. It’s extremely unfriendly to newcomers—especially people like me who only knew about Persona 5 and thought this new title might be a good entry point. The story is only slightly above the level of an average anime. The characters are all stock archetypes (no pun intended) you can find in countless shows of the same genre. Their personalities never develop; they stay flat from beginning to end. Even the protagonist is bland—there’s nothing interesting about him, and everyone feels like a narrative tool serving an average plot that tries to look profound but ends up contradictory, preachy, and shallow. As for the gameplay, it’s standard JRPG fare but with less freedom and far less tolerance for mistakes. I played on normal difficulty, and as a newcomer, an early mission punished me harshly for messing up my time planning. I wasted an entire in-game period and made zero progress, forcing me to restart a whole dungeon. If you’re new and want to play casually or freely, you’re basically doomed. The calendar system seems designed to make you feel immersed, but it only left me stressed, constantly pushing me to rush through a style of gameplay I wasn’t familiar with—and that was incredibly irritating. I eventually platinumed it just to squeeze a tiny bit of value out of what I paid, and it ended up being one of the most nightmarish gaming experiences I’ve ever had. Again: if you’re not already a traditional JRPG fan, DO NOT buy it. Metaphor clearly caters well to its existing fanbase, but it fails miserably at welcoming new players.

This product entitles you to download both the digital PS4® version and the digital PS5® version of this game.

The ATLUS 35th Digital Anniversary Edition includes exclusive DLCs to further enhance your Metaphor: ReFantazio journey and commemorate past ATLUS titles.

1. Digital Base Game
2. Digital Artbook
3. Digital Soundtrack
4. Atlus 35th Digital History Book
5. Atlus 35th Digital All-Time Best Soundtrack
6. Over 50 DLC costumes, Battle BGMs, and Jingle Sets including:
- Shujin Academy School Uniform
- Golden Yasogami High School Uniform
- Gekkoukan High School Uniform
- Seven Sisters High School Uniform
- St. Hermelin High School Uniform
- Jouin High School Uniform
- Samurai Garb
- Etrian Odyssey Series Classes Costume
